Requirements for Washington Registered Agents
In order to operate as a registered agent in Washington, one must be a dweller of the state or a business entity authorized to conduct business in Washington. This guarantees that the agent is available to receive legal documents and formal notifications on behalf of the company. People acting as registered agents must provide a real address within the state, as P.O. boxes are not acceptable for this purpose.
Furthermore, registered agents in Washington must have to be at least 18 years of age. This age requirement is important, as it guarantees that the agent can take legal responsibility for receiving crucial papers and communicating them to the business in a timely manner. Common Misconceptions Concerning Registered Agents
Many people believe that registered agents are only necessary for significant businesses or corporations. This belief can lead minor business owners to neglect the necessity of having a registered agent. In reality, all business entity, irrespective of size, is required to have a registered agent in Washington. This makes certain that there is a reliable point of contact for legal documents and enables the business to stay compliant with state regulations.
Another common misunderstanding is that a registered agent must be a lawyer or a professional service. While numerous businesses opt to hire professional registered agents, it is not a necessity. Business owners in Washington can serve as their own registered agent if they have a real address in the state. However, it is crucial to reflect on the ramifications of acting as your own agent, as it could lead to missed communications or legal issues if you are unavailable.
